#1c6c24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c6c24 is composed of 11% red, 42.4%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 126 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 26.7%. #1c6c24 color hex could be obtained by blending #38d848 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1c6c24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c6c24 has RGB values of R:28, G:108,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 1862692.

Shades and Tints of #1c6c24
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f05 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c6c24
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414741 is the less saturated color, while #02860f is the most saturated one.
